Cake
“Let them eat cake” is one of the most famous sayings in history. While the phrase is attributed to the Queen of France, Queen Marie Antoinette, nobody actually knows who said it. It was said in a time of social and political turmoil in revolutionary France as a response that disregarded the plight of poor people. Today, anyone can eat cake—it’s a staple at birthday parties, graduations, anniversaries, and other celebrations.

Pie
The phrase “as American as apple pie” is a bit misleading because apples didn’t actually come from America. Apples actually come from Central Asia and China is actually the biggest producer of apples. Europeans brought apples to the New World, and Americans have had apple pie since its founding in the 18th century. By the 20th century, apple pie was seen as a symbol of national pride.
